MAJORANA,LYCEE TOULOUSE LAUTREC,Pravno-poslovna skola Nis,IES LUIS SEOANEFunder: European Commission Project Code: 2018-1-ES01-KA202-050980Funder Contribution: 165,270 EUROur project was based on the PROEMO (Professional-Emotions) methodology. It consisted of learning to manage emotions in a professional environment in order to create a more efficient and effective workplace. This emotional education was undertaken in the modern European context, in which individuals must develop linguistic and multicultural abilities as well. Specific training on Emotional and Entrepreneurial Education emphasized the fact that each person interpreted events differently based on their own life experiences. Research has shown that many work environments were overwhelmingly negative and contributed to burnout syndrome among employees. Developing the empathy of their staff improved teamwork and school moral, as mutual understanding, respect, and support were crucial for a healthy personal and professional life. These values had been developed in an international context, focusing on the different lifestyles, cultural traditions, and linguistic diversity of the project partners, with the aim of building mutual respect and tolerance. Participants had the opportunity to interact with European peers of varying ages, genders, ethnicities, religions, and socioeconomic classes. They could improve their English and communicate using modern technology. Although emotional and linguistic development focused on individuals within the project, the ripple effect allowed those individuals to share their newfound skills with their peers, their educational communities, and their societies. more_vert assignment_turned_in ProjectPartners:College Champ d Eymet, Pravno-poslovna skola NisCollege Champ d Eymet,Pravno-poslovna skola NisFunder: European Commission Project Code: 2019-1-FR01-KA229-062320Funder Contribution: 47,492 EURA European project with multiple goals both pedagogical and cultural. We can cite 2:1) Work between 2 teams who have the same goal of training students in civil security but who have different approaches. These Approaches are related to the local contexts and history of each school. The objective is to develop and increase pedagogical practices through a rapprochement of the 2 teaching teams both by regular exchanges through the digital channel and by 2 meetings per year through immersion in the classroom. This approach can only encourage the progress of one or the other team and tend towards a harmonization of the practices.2) Pellegrue College is located in an isolated rural geographical area and hosts a predominantly disadvantaged population (62%) wants to engage in a project that allows its students a cultural and international opening. Welcoming young Serbs to his family for two weeks a year, then living in a Serbian family for two weeks a year beyond immersion in the class of a Serbian school and the discovery of his school system seems to bring us elements needed for cultural and international openness for our students and their parents.Finally, it should be noted that the exchanges will all be in English.

What will be the activities, short description of results andlonger term benefits:-We will search our regional old dishes which were cooked by our grannies visiting, interviewing them in their villages,houses and we want them to prepare for us their some of traditional dishes. We'll record and get the recipe of them. -We'll press a book of our grannies' dishes with the recipes which we'll get and we'll sell them for the grant of people in need, disabled old. With this we'll not only have dissemination of the project but also tell the importance of traditional dishes in health. -We'll organize meetings and forums on importance of traditional dishes on healthy nutrition and we'll invite the restaurant and hotel owners to these forums and at the end we'll want them put some of these cultural and regional dishes to their Menus to dissemination. -We'll organize workshops with kindergarten pupils. We'll cook traditional and healthy snacks like rusks, ring cracks or dishes with them, we'll give information about healthy nutrition and importance of our grannies' food on this.-We'll cook our grannies' dishes at school and take them to people in need and old also to our grannies who are in need and we'll tell them about our project with this not only our students will learn solidarity and openness and tolerance towards all diversities, the need to help another human being.-We'll organize competitions on best traditional and regional food. With this we'll disseminate the project among the community.-Our students grow their own organic vegetables at the fields of school and they gain the responsibility, this will decrease early school leaving and they learn how to grow their own material to cook. The participants of the project are about 500 students and 30 teachers from partner schools from Italy, Croatia, Lithuania, Belgium, Serbia and Turkey, who will be involved in the project activities both at local and international level. There'll be 5 short-term exchanges of students in each partner country, in which 180 students and 72 teachers will participate in workshops, trainings and actions.
